Plasma cysteine, cystine, and glutathione in cirrhosis

WebPlasma cystine is also strongly associated with BMI ( r = 0.49, P < 0.001, N = 47) [20 ]. However, cysteine is distinct from other amino acids that are elevated in plasma in obesity in several aspects, as discussed below. Experimental and epidemiologic evidence suggests that cysteine could be an unrecognized determinant of body weight. Method Name Liquid Chromatography Tandem Mass Spectrometry (LC-MS/MS) NY State Available Yes … WebSimilar to plasma tCys, free blood cysteine was positively correlated with BMI (cohort described in ref. 34; Figure 3). This may indicate that it is the high plasma cysteine availability in both cells and plasma, rather than a shift in cysteine compartmentation between blood cells and plasma, that is associated with obesity.

WebCystathionine is an intermediary metabolite that is formed in the sequential enzymatic conversion of methionine to cysteine. Cystathionine is normally detected at very low levels in plasma.
